Bought one, then bought a second. Enough said.
I have a 'smart TV' that probably will never be updated, that was having all sorts of issues running Netflix and Plex. Bought one of these direct from Vodafone, and it's been great. So good in fact I got another one to smarten up an old dumb tv. We also have a HD Homerun so can use that to watch live tv, rather than the built in tuner. They recently updated to Android 9.0 which is good, and has been very stable although admittedly we don't ask much of it. If you want a really good Android TV box then you should probably spend the extra and get ...Read more
an Nvidia Shield. That costs maybe four times more than this though. The only strange thing that it doesn't directly support yet is Amazon Prime video. Netflix, Disney, Stan, Plex, sure. Amazon - nope. There are ways to get it on with mixed reports on how successful it is, but for now the best way is simply to cast Prime from a mobile device. Basically, it's not a great android tv box but it's definitely a good one. For the price, it's hard to beat.

Best value Android TV box on the market
Pros
- Runs Android TV for streaming
- TV card tuner included
- Not locked so will run any Android app, including Kodi, not just those from the Play Store
- Excellent zippy remote
- Fully licensed for Google, Netflix etc (unlike cheap Chinese boxes) with L1 Widevine support
- Chromecast built-in
- 2.4/5ghz wifi and ethernet port
Cons...Read more
- Low disk storage (8gb) but can be expanded via the USB port - Amlogic 905 processor + 2gb ram = average hardware performance - No auto frame-rate switching - Basic TV guide and limited recording function This combined streaming TV/set-top box is a bargain. At $72 it's worth it just for Chromecast. It runs Google's Android TV for easy navigation and untold streaming options - Netflix, Youtube, Amazon, etc, as well as Kodi and much more. The remote is great and picture quality good, though home cinema buffs might want to opt for a top-end box like the Nvidia Shield. For most viewing though, this box is terrific, with 4-star performance, but it gets an extra star for exceptional value.Purchased in June 2021 at Vodafone for A$72.00.
